The image on my current rig is very small. About 5 GB for just the windows image and apps themselves (basic apps and motherboard drivers, and all lof the operating system tweaks. Cable modem tweaks, registry edits - everything. It restores it to like new. Right now I use Acronis and like it better than Norton. As a matter of fact, im going to restore a fresh image tonight as well as build an M7NCG 400 system with a barton for my In Laws :) Should take about 3 hours to build and tuck wires very neat and I'll Prime 95 it overnight. There are other ways of doing it without an image. You can boot to your windows CD and pick reinstall the operating system, you would get a fresh installl, but you would have to reinstall most apps and get SP1 and DX9 again ... etc... alot of people do it that way. Or use system restore to a known good point.
